About this banknote
The Central Bank of Sri Lanka issued the 100 Rupees banknote (Pick 105c) on July 1, 1992, featuring the signatures of D. B. Wijethunga and H. B. Disanayaka. This note was part of a series introduced to update the nation's currency designs during the early 1990s.
The obverse displays a decorative urn on the right side. The reverse features tea leaf pickers, two Rose-ringed Parakeets at the bottom, and Sigiriya rock in the background. The banknote measures 143 x 72 mm and was printed by Thomas De La Rue & Co.
